I received my Armytrix exhaust few days back. Austin from Vivid Racing also helped with the order. I had the exhaust installed at Driver Source (exotic car service center) in Houston.

Since the exhaust been installed, the car rattles and vibrates at 600-900 rpm. I took my car back to the service center to get it checked but they can't find anything wrong with the install. The exhaust is properly mounted and secured. I actually went over all bolts and nuts myself while it was on their lift. They did an excellent job mounting the system.

Vivid assured me a follow up from an Armytrix tech last week but to date no one has contacted either me or the service center.....

I believe Vivid is trying to get this corrected...they asked for a video/sound clip as according to Vivid racing, Armytrix will not engage on a post install issues without the clip so now I will be taking my car back to the service center on Monday for the 3rd time so they can try and capture the rattling and vibration on a video clip....

I've waited over two months to have that system shipped only to go through all this frustration and wasted cycles.... So far my experience is terrible to say the least.

I'm still hopeful that Armytrix will do the right thing and provide the much needed support to one of their paying customers...most defiantly, their follow up has been way below expectation, not what one would expect paying close to 5k for their system

I will send out an update next week to let you all know how it went.

We offer a few set ups that work with the PSE if you have install and for those who don't you can add it.

For cars already equipped with PSE I would highly recommended our Valvetronic Center Muffler Bypass X-Pipe. When closed this will give you a more aggressive sound over stock yet being tame and manageable. When you open up the valves the x-pipe provides a straight through path to dump the exhaust out to the tips.

Valvetronic Center Muffler Bypass X-Pipe (for PSE only)





For cars that are not already PSE equipped we offer a Valvetronic Exhaust System that includes the Valvetronic X-Pipe listed above as well as Side Mufflers with Tips and a vacuum valve controller. This system fuctions the same way as I listed above giving you a more aggressive yet manageable tone when closed and a more extreme tone when open for spirited back road driving!
